I'm leaving Hong Kong and need to send a box of personal items to Australia- total weight 20kg. I guess the cheapest option is to send it by sea freight. Can anyone suggest a cheap, reliable freight forwarder?

Just did the same thing - sent it via Hong Kong post. But there are restrictions on size, so you need to buy the dedicated post packs from the post office first - absolute max to Aust is 20kg, so you could even split between 2 boxes if need be. We found it to be the cheapest by far - takes 6-8 weeks according to the information we received.


Insurance is also cheap through the Post.

the maximum ive sent is about 15kg - around hk$330 which included the insurance. Looked at the baggage company, but for the amount we were sending, comparing costs it worked out much cheaper using HK post.

Pick up from the nearest post office at receiving end.
